Privacy landscaping services focus on creating outdoor spaces that provide homeowners with increased seclusion and personal space. These services typically involve installing features such as privacy fences, dense plantings, hedges, and strategic landscape design elements that block views from neighbors or passersby. The goal is to establish a natural or constructed barrier that enhances comfort and helps homeowners enjoy their yard without feeling exposed. Whether it's a backyard retreat or a side yard that needs screening, privacy landscaping can transform outdoor areas into more private and peaceful environments.

Many common problems that privacy landscaping addresses include noise disturbance, unwanted visual intrusion, and a lack of personal space in the yard. For homes situated in busy neighborhoods or near roads, noise reduction can significantly improve outdoor comfort. Similarly, homes with neighboring properties close by often benefit from visual screening that prevents neighbors from overlooking the yard. Privacy landscaping can also help define outdoor living zones, making patios, decks, or play areas more secluded and inviting. This service is especially useful for homeowners seeking to create a more intimate or secure outdoor environment.

Properties that typically utilize privacy landscaping services vary widely but generally include single-family homes, especially those with smaller yards or close-set neighbors. Larger residential lots may also benefit from privacy features to section off different areas of the yard or to shield outdoor living spaces. In addition, properties with pools, patios, or outdoor kitchens often seek privacy landscaping to enhance their usability and comfort. Commercial properties, such as small businesses or community centers, may also use these services to create private outdoor zones for clients or visitors. Overall, privacy landscaping is a practical solution for any property where increased seclusion is desired.

The overview below groups typical Privacy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wilmington,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or landscaping adjustments or repairs typ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s, such as fixing damaged plantings or minor erosion control,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s can increase the cost beyond this band.

Mid-Range Landscaping - Projects like replanting beds, installing new mulch, or minor redesigns generally range from $600 to $2,000. Most projects of this size are completed within this bracket, with fewer reaching the upper end for added features or extensive work.

Full Landscaping Overhaul - Complete landscape redesigns or large-scale installations often cost between $2,000 and $5,000. Many service providers handle projects in this range, though larger, more complex projects can exceed $5,000+ depending on scope.

Complete Property Makeover - Extensive landscaping services, including comprehensive outdoor renovations, can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. Such projects are less common and tend to involve detailed planning and high-end features, with costs varying based on size and compl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ating landscape service providers for privacy landscaping projects in Wilmington, NC,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. Homeowners should inquire about how long a contractor has been working on privacy-focused landscaping and whether they have completed projects comparable in scope and style. A contractor with a solid track record of handling similar projects is more likely to understand the unique challenges involved and deliver results that meet expectations. Reviewing portfolios or asking for examples of past work can provide insight into their expertise and whether their style aligns with the homeowner’s vision.

Clear written expectations are essential to ensure that both the homeowner and the service provider are aligned from the start. When comparing local contractors, it’s helpful to ask for det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and specific responsibilities.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Homeowners should also clarify any questions about the process upfront, ensuring that the contractor’s approach and deliverables are well understood before work begins.

Reputable references and strong communication are key indicators of a reliable service provider. Homeowners can ask potential contractors for references from previous clients who had similar privacy landscaping needs. Speaking with these references can reveal insights about the contractor’s professionalism, quality of work, and ability to meet deadlines. Good communication-being responsive, transparent, and attentive to questions-also contributes to a smoother project experience. How do privacy landscaping services protect my property's privacy? Privacy landscaping services use strategic plantings, fences, and natural barriers to block views and create secluded outdoor spaces tailored to your property's layout and your privacy preferences.

Can privacy landscaping be customized to fit my yard's size and shape? Yes, local contractors can design privacy solutions that suit the specific size, shape, and features of your yard, ensuring effective privacy without overwhelming the space.

What types of plants are typically used in privacy landscaping? Service providers often incorporate dense evergreen shrubs, tall grasses, and trees that maintain their foliage year-round to provide consistent privacy and aesthetic appeal.

Is privacy landscaping suitable for all types of properties? Privacy landscaping can be adapted to various property types, whether residential or commercial, and tailored to fit different landscape styles and privacy needs.

How do local contractors ensure that privacy landscaping complements my existing outdoor design? Professionals consider your current landscape features and personal style to integrate privacy elements seamlessly, enhancing both privacy and visual appeal.
